Horse Trailer Insulation — Roof and Wall Panels

Coating the roof stops the heat coming through the top. Insulation panels stop it radiating into the space where the horses actually stand. We install roof and wall insulation panels and finished interior wall panels — the pair of them together is what turns a hot aluminum box into something you can haul in through a Florida summer.

Common questions

Should I insulate as well as coat the roof?

They do different jobs. Coating reflects heat off the outside and waterproofs the roof; insulation stops what does get through from radiating down onto the horses. Done together they make the biggest difference.

Can you insulate a trailer that is already coated?

Yes — the two jobs are independent and can be done in either order.
